One of the main objections around chatrooms is that they are too open to abuse by spoilers.
They are very hard to moderate effectively and once a row has kicked off on the chatroom it has a tendency to sour the forums when it inevitably spills over.

As someone who has had to clean up the mess caused by bad relations on chatrooms which have spilled over onto a sites forums I would counsel against the idea.
